Valhalla

Scottish producer Hostage just dropped one thunderous EP with “Valhalla” (released by Nightshifters that goes from strength to strength with their releases). Hostage keeps the single going with bass and adds some sprinkles of rave to keep the dancefloor in check, remix duties comes from Chicago house legend Angel Alanis, Chicago b-more hero Rampage then Chrissy Murderbot adds some juke flavour and Mommas Boy finishes the package off with some Dutch house/Euro rave goodness.

ZNMA

DJ Donna Summer (boss man of the powerhouse known as the Nightshifters label) was asked to do a new DJ mix for Russian vodka company ZNMA. It’s actually pronounced “Zima” but that’s the Russian word for winter. The mix is available in a Deluxe Digi-pack format in Russia but they want it to be spread all around so here’s the mp3. The mix consists of 100% Nightshifters tracks with a lot of exclusive new tracks a well as a few older favorites.

Udachi & Jubilee – Paypur + Smoke Rings (video)

Nightshifters continues with their heavy bass induced world takeover, their next release comes from two of NYCs finest dj’s/producers, namely Udachi and Jubilee who gives us the “Paypur EP”.

“We’re proud to present our next EP, this time a collaborative effort between two of New York’s Hottest DJ/producers Udachi and Jubilee! A beast of a release, Paypur features two incredible original tracks by the duo and five stunning remixes. AC Slater states “This could easily be the biggest release of 2009. I’ve been playing this in every one of my DJ sets for the past 6 months.” Garnering support from the likes of Tommie Sunshine, Fake Blood, DJ Craze, and Klever, and BBC Radio 1 Airplay on Kissy Sellouts show, it has breakthrough potential! “Paypur” begins on a mellow old school tip with an 808 bounce that builds into an oscillating frenzy of a drop. The track follows an imaginary clubber on his first night out, he thinks he has the swag, but the push and pull of the track shows the subtle comedy of someone succumbing to too much “fun”, then regresses from the perfect bliss of mixed substances before hurling it up with a psychedelic whine of chest thumping bass.

“Smoke Rings” includes Jubilee on vocals crooning over a dub-reggae breakdown about aliens stealing her weed. The best slices in like a rip in the space-time continuum sending Jess on a chase to get the weed back. If you want to know how the story ends, the crooner gets her weed back and parties with the aliens back on Planet Rad! A happy ending indeed…

While the two original tracks are simply amazing, the remixes are equally incredible. Nick Catchdubs enlists hot-as-fuck lyricist Kid Daytona to re-construct Paypur into a screwed dirty south styled jam filled with swagger and ready for radio airplay. Venezuela’s Cardopusher pushes the bass to the maxx with his mosh-pit-dubstep remix of the same tune, while Thunderheist’s Grahmzilla flips the vibe into an expansive techno affair ready for your next sunrise session. Breakbeat hardcore legend Luna-C turns “Smoke Rings” into a dub-bass rave anthem of the next level akin to ‘SL2 on a ragga tip’. And while a rave vibe can also be felt in Dre Skull’s incredible remix, he pushes up the Funky snares and adds a sinister breakdown that’s sure to get shirts flung off the dance floor.”

Rampage

We’ve been mad sleeping on this (Sorry Jason and Jess) but finally i managed to sit down for a post about this new Rampage release on the consistently awesome Nightshifters label.

Rampage is part of the Ghetto Division crew in Chicago along with Rob Threezy, Charlie Glitch and MaddJazz and his new EP “War” is the latest release on NYC/Berlin based Nightshifters. The track that we got for you today – “Loving You Is Easy” – is on that blasting housed up b-more style that Rampage has become noted for.
